No, I am not a paid captain. It is my boat that I built myself from
bare timber (sheathed in GRP) - hence wooden mast, poured sockets for
the rigging and other bronze fittings cast from my own patterns, etc.,
and launched in '93 in New Zealand. The 'owner' refered to is "the"
wife.

Yes it is a long way and there are few people I would sail such a
distance with. Unfortunately these all have job commitments, get sea
sick or are in poor health. A lot of the solo sailors I have met have
tried taking on crew in the past and finally decided it was easier to
sail alone.
